Understanding Drone Categories and Use Cases
Today's drone market breaks down into several distinct categories, each optimized for specific applications. Consumer camera drones dominate the market, designed primarily for aerial photography and videography with features like automated flight modes and obstacle avoidance. It's the ideal drone for content creators, travel vloggers, photographers and even enthusiasts who want to have fun.
Racing and FPV drones represent the high-performance segment, built for speed and agility rather than stability and ease of use. These machines prioritize lightweight construction, responsive controls, and durability to withstand inevitable crashes during learning and competition.
Commercial and professional drones serve specialized industries like mapping, surveying, inspection, and search and rescue. These platforms typically offer longer flight times, advanced sensors, and enterprise-grade software integration.
Finally, toy and educational drones provide safe, affordable entry points for new pilots and young enthusiasts to learn basic flight skills without significant financial risk.
Key Features to Consider Before Buying
Camera quality remains the most important factor for most drone buyers in 2026. With 4K resolution, you can enjoy sharper and more detailed imagery, enabling precise cropping, smooth cinematic footage, and future-proof content that remains stunning on high-resolution displays. This level of detail provides a richer viewing experience and offers flexibility in post-production, allowing for enhanced editing and creative freedom without sacrificing quality, making it an indispensable feature for professionals and enthusiasts alike.
Flight time directly impacts your creative potential and operational efficiency. Modern drones offer anywhere from 10 minutes to over 45 minutes of flight time per battery. Consider purchasing additional batteries if you plan extended shooting sessions.
Range and connectivity determine how far you can fly and maintain a stable video feed. Advanced drones now offer 10+ kilometer ranges with HD video transmission, though legal restrictions typically limit practical flying distances.
Safety features like obstacle avoidance, return-to-home functionality, and GPS positioning have become standard on quality drones. These systems prevent crashes and help recover lost aircraft, making them especially valuable for new pilots.

FAA Registration Requirements and Compliance
Understanding legal requirements is crucial before making any drone purchase. If your drone weighs between 0.55 pounds (250 grams) and 55 pounds, you must register. If you are unsure of your drone's weight, check the manufacturer specifications or use a small kitchen scale to weigh the aircraft with the battery and propellers attached.
Part 107 registration costs $5 per drone and is valid for three (3) years. The Exception for Limited Recreational Operations registration costs $5, covers all drones in your inventory, and is valid for three (3) years. Registration must be completed before your first flight, and the registration number must be clearly visible on the exterior of your aircraft.
As of 2024, most drones required to be registered must also comply with Remote ID rules. When you register your drone through the FAA DroneZone, you will be asked for a Remote ID Serial Number. This digital license plate system broadcasts your drone's identification and location during flight for enhanced airspace safety.

Safety Features for New Pilots
Modern beginner drones incorporate multiple safety systems to prevent crashes and protect your investment. GPS positioning enables precise hovering and automatic return-to-home functionality when the battery runs low or connection is lost. Obstacle avoidance sensors detect and avoid collisions with trees, buildings, and other obstacles.
Geofencing prevents flight in restricted airspace near airports and military installations. Beginner flight modes limit speed and altitude while providing enhanced stability for learning basic maneuvers. These features work together to create a forgiving learning environment that builds skills gradually.

Recommended Training Drones and Mini Drones
Ultra-lightweight training drones under 250 grams offer the perfect introduction to drone flying without registration requirements. All of these drones weigh under 250 grams. Drones under 250 grams are a big deal because many types of federal drone regulations do not apply to drones of that size. In the U.S., drones under 250 grams do not need to be registered with the FAA for recreational operations.
Indoor training drones with propeller guards allow safe practice in confined spaces during bad weather. These tiny aircraft teach basic orientation, throttle control, and spatial awareness without the risk of outdoor hazards or wind interference. Many pilots recommend mastering indoor flight before progressing to larger outdoor drones.

4K and Cinema-Quality Recording Capabilities
Modern camera drones capture stunning 4K footage at various frame rates for different creative applications. Standard 4K/30fps provides smooth, cinematic motion, while 4K/60fps enables silky slow-motion effects when played back at normal speed. The most advanced drones now offer 4K/120fps for extreme slow-motion creativity.
Professional color profiles like D-Log preserve maximum dynamic range during filming, allowing extensive color grading in post-production. These flat profiles capture more detail in highlights and shadows, essential for matching drone footage with traditional cameras in professional productions.
High-resolution still photography capabilities now reach 50+ megapixels on flagship drones, delivering print-quality images suitable for commercial use. RAW format support provides maximum editing flexibility for professional photographers.
Gimbal Stability and Image Quality Factors
Three-axis mechanical gimbals provide rock-steady footage even in challenging wind conditions. These precision-engineered systems isolate the camera from drone movements, delivering smooth cinematic results that rival traditional stabilized camera rigs.
Larger camera sensors capture more light and detail, particularly important for aerial photography where lighting conditions change rapidly. the Mini 3 boasts a 1/1.3-inch sensor capable of shooting 4K HDR video. It also has features like dual native ISO for low-light performance.
Advanced image processing algorithms optimize footage in real-time, reducing noise, enhancing colors, and maintaining sharpness across the frame. These computational photography techniques ensure consistent, high-quality results regardless of shooting conditions.
Best Drones for Real Estate and Content Creation
Real estate professionals require drones that deliver consistent, high-quality footage with minimal setup time. Automated flight modes like orbit, waypoint navigation, and slider shots create professional marketing materials without requiring advanced piloting skills.
Content creators benefit from features like ActiveTrack subject following, which automatically keeps moving subjects in frame while maintaining smooth camera movement. Gesture controls allow solo creators to operate the drone hands-free for selfies and action shots.
Quick Shot modes provide pre-programmed camera movements that create dynamic footage with the tap of a button. These include dronie, helix, boomerang, and asteroid shots that would be challenging to execute manually but produce engaging social media content.
